VPS能远程控制吗?_详解VPS远程连接方法与常见问题解决方案

VPS可以通过哪些方式进行远程控制?

远程控制方式 适用系统 默认端口 主要特点
SSH Linux/Unix 22 命令行界面,安全性高
RDP Windows 3389 图形化界面,操作直观
VNC 跨平台 5900 远程桌面共享
Web控制台 云服务商提供 自定义 浏览器直接访问

VPS远程控制完全指南

VPS(虚拟专用服务器)作为云端独立的计算资源,其核心价值就在于能够实现远程控制和管理。无论是Linux系统还是Windows系统,VPS都提供了多种远程控制方式,让用户可以随时随地管理自己的服务器。

VPS远程控制的主要方法

控制方式 适用场景 优势 技术要求
SSH连接 Linux服务器管理 安全性高、资源消耗低 命令行操作基础
RDP连接 Windows服务器管理 图形化界面、操作简便 网络带宽要求较高
VNC连接 跨平台远程桌面 灵活性好、支持多种系统 需要额外安装配置
控制台访问 紧急救援和初始设置 不依赖网络配置、基础保障 功能相对有限

分步骤详细操作流程

步骤一:SSH远程连接Linux VPS

操作说明 SSH是连接Linux VPS最常用的方式,通过加密的通信通道确保安全性。 使用工具提示
  • Windows系统:PuTTY、Windows Terminal
  • macOS/Linux系统:终端(Terminal)
  • 跨平台:MobaXterm、SecureCRT
# 使用命令行连接VPS
ssh username@yourvpsip -p 22

首次连接时的认证提示

The authenticity of host 'yourvpsip (yourvpsip)' can't be established. ECDSA key fingerprint is SHA256:xxxxxxxxxxxxxxxx. Are you sure you want to continue connecting (yes/no/[fingerprint])? yes

输入密码

username@yourvpsip's password:

步骤二:RDP远程连接Windows VPS

操作说明 RDP提供完整的图形化界面,操作体验接近本地计算机。 使用工具提示
  • Windows系统:内置远程桌面连接
  • macOS:Microsoft Remote Desktop
  • Linux:Remmina、rdesktop
远程桌面连接界面配置:
计算机: yourvpsip
用户名: administrator
密码: ****
显示选项:
分辨率: 1920x1080
颜色质量: 真彩色(32位)

步骤三:VNC跨平台远程控制

操作说明 VNC适用于需要图形化界面但又没有RDP服务的Linux系统。 使用工具提示
  • 服务器端:TightVNC、RealVNC
  • 客户端:VNC Viewer、RealVNC Viewer
VNC服务器配置:
VNC Server: yourvpsip:5901
Password: ****
连接选项:
编码方式: Tight
画质: 中等

步骤四:Web控制台访问

操作说明 大多数云服务商提供基于浏览器的控制台访问,用于网络故障时的紧急管理。 使用工具提示
  • 直接通过云服务商管理面板访问
  • 无需额外软件安装
Web控制台登录界面:
云服务商: [阿里云/腾讯云/AWS等]
实例ID: i-xxxxxxxx
访问方式: VNC登录
功能限制:
仅支持基础操作
文件传输受限

常见问题及解决方案

问题 原因 解决方案
连接超时或拒绝连接 防火墙阻挡、端口未开放、VPS未运行 检查安全组规则、确认服务状态、验证网络连通性
认证失败 用户名密码错误、SSH密钥配置问题 重置密码、检查密钥权限、确认认证方式
连接缓慢或卡顿 网络延迟高、带宽不足、服务器负载高 优化网络路由、升级带宽配置、检查系统资源使用情况
图形界面显示异常 色彩设置不当、分辨率不匹配、驱动问题 调整显示参数、更新显卡驱动、重新安装桌面环境

连接超时的深度排查

当遇到连接超时问题时,需要进行系统性排查:
  1. 网络连通性测试
ping yourvpsip
traceroute yourvpsip
  1. 端口状态检查
telnet yourvpsip 22  # 测试SSH端口
telnet yourvpsip 3389 # 测试RDP端口
  1. 服务状态确认
# Linux系统检查SSH服务
systemctl status sshd
ps aux | grep ssh

Windows系统检查RDP服务

netstat -an | findstr 3389

安全性配置建议

远程控制VPS时,安全性是首要考虑因素:
  • 修改默认端口:将SSH的22端口或RDP的3389端口修改为非常用端口
  • 使用密钥认证:SSH连接优先使用密钥对替代密码认证
  • 配置防火墙规则:仅允许特定IP地址访问管理端口
  • 启用双因素认证:重要操作增加额外验证步骤

性能优化技巧

为了获得更好的远程控制体验:
  • SSH连接优化:使用压缩和连接保持功能
  • RDP体验提升:调整位图缓存和颜色深度
  • 网络优化:选择优质的网络线路和服务商
通过掌握这些远程控制方法,您将能够充分发挥VPS的计算能力,无论是网站部署、应用开发还是数据处理,都能获得流畅的管理体验。选择适合自己需求和技术水平的远程控制方式,是高效使用VPS的关键所在。

发表评论

评论列表